Background 

 

Li-ion batteries are expected to meet the challenges of the electrification of the automotive sector. Its components need to be selected on the basis of attributes such as performance, safety and durability. Li-ion cells with different form factors; cylindrical, pouch, prismatic, have been proposed and each type of cell has advantages and disadvantages in terms of manufacturing, packaging density, and properties such as energy, impedance, etc. Cylindrical cells with increased capacity, e.g. the 46xx series, have been recently proposed, likely enhancing their utilization in battery packs.  

 

The goal of this project is to characterize cylindrical Li-ion cells for automotive applications to get insights into their performance and ageing phenomena, when exposed to accelerated aging. Techniques that will be used are, but not limited to, Galvanostatic cycling and Electrochemical Impedance Spectroscopy (EIS). Furthermore, insights into cell design will be given.
